North Texas Collegiate Academy-Eas is an charter elementary school in Little Elm, TX, in the North Texas Collegiate Academy school district. As of the 2020-2021 school year, it had 189 students. 72% of students were considered at risk of dropping out of school. 24.3% of students were enrolled in bilingual and English language learning programs.
Because of the coronavirus pandemic, the state waived accountability ratings for the 2020-2021 school year. The school received an accountability rating of F for the 2018-2019 school year.
As of the 2020-2021 school year, an average teacher's salary was $50,585, which is $7,056 less than the state average. On average, teachers had 3.4 years of experience.

Accountability ratings
Texas assigns ratings to districts and campuses that designate their performance in relation to the state's accountability system.
Because of the coronavirus pandemic, the state waived accountability ratings for the 2020-2021 school year. All Texas public school districts and campuses received the label “Not Rated: Declared State of Disaster.” Our schools explorer shows the accountability ratings from the 2018-2019 school year when available.

The overall grades are based on three categories: student achievement (how well students perform academically), school progress (how well students perform over time and compared to students in similar schools) and closing the gaps (how well schools are boosting performance for subgroups such as students with special needs).
